Tea Tree Oil Face Spots: Do They Really Work?

Many users are interested if using tea tree oil undiluted to face blemishes can really clear them up . While tea tree oil possesses proven antimicrobial properties that could fight problematic bacteria, using it without dilution is generally discouraged . It's a concentrated ingredient and can lead to inflammation or even burns if not diluted . Therefore, while promising , relying solely on tea tree oil face spots for total elimination might prove ineffective. A small test area is always advised before widespread use .

Skincare Spotlight: Essential Extracts for Acne-Prone Skin

Dealing with breakouts can be a frustrating experience, but certain plant-based compounds may offer assistance . Melaleuca oil is a well-known choice due to its antibacterial properties, helping to reduce bacteria that contribute to zits. the Lavender flower can ease red skin and support healing , while Clary Sage extract is thought to aid with hormone regulation , a common factor in certain breakout cases. Remember to dilute these powerful oils with a moisturizing oil like grapeseed oil before putting to the skin and perform a small test area first to verify for any adverse reactions throughout the application process .
